Environmental Engine Developer Rotoblock Inc. (OTCBB:ROTB) Names Richard H. DiStefano COO
Thursday, June 05, 2008 7:07 AM

New Management Addition Facilitates Companys US-China Expansion

Environmental engine technology firm Rotoblock Inc. (OTCBB:ROTB) announces the appointment of Richard H. DiStefano as Chief Operating Officer. The recent addition is integral to the company’s business plan and its US-China expansion.

Mr. DiStefano is a business strategist with 13 years experience managing multiple product lines in both the corporate and entrepreneurial environments. He has broad-based experience with companies like IAC, match.com, Premier Wireless, and Hansen Beverage Company involved in management, planning, business development, product development and marketing.

According to Rotoblock CEO Mr. Chien Chih Liu, “The addition of Mr. DiStefano as COO will help with the Company's recently planned expansion." In May Rotoblock agreed to acquire controlling interest in Hikom Gottell Corporation for US $25 Million. The US-China venture intends to develop and manufacture small engines, air-conditioning systems and other consumer and industrial equipment.

"Mr. DiStefano has a balanced background with a proven track record in business development," said Mr. Liu. "I believe he will be an excellent addition to Rotoblock, bringing new ideas that will be of strategic importance to future growth."

In February DiStefano was promoted to Senior Director for IAC (InterActive Corp.). Prior to this, he spent the past three years as Director of Mobile Products for match.com, which was acquired by IAC in 1999. DiStefano was instrumental in developing and launching SMS alerts, an integrated WAP site and Brew downloadable client applications with AT&T, Sprint, Virgin, Alltel and Telefonica in Spain. He led the global on-deck expansion into the UK and Spain with Vodafone and Orange. He also created and launched an off-deck model for match and MSN dating and personals in the US and 14 additional countries.

"Rotoblock is in a very dynamic situation internationally with its business focus of energy efficiency and advanced technology," said DiStefano. "I think the opportunity and timing is critical with all of the changes taking place throughout the world, and in particular China."

Mr. DiStefano is also an entrepreneur, founding San Francisco-based Premier Wireless in 2003, which now operates 12 outlets that have formed dealer relationships with Sprint, Verizon, Cingular, T-Mobile and Metro PCS. In 1994, he was the founder of Video City in Davis, California which he turned to profitability in its first year and led the sale to new ownership 10 years later.
